BL.INK

BL.INK provides an enterprise-grade solution that specializes in secure link management and detailed attribution tracking for large organizations. You can create short, descriptive, word-based links that are easy to share via SMS or voice, enhancing your customer engagement. The platform is particularly suitable if you operate in regulated industries like finance or healthcare, as it maintains high security standards including SOC2 and HIPAA compliance.

In addition to link shortening, you gain access to a no-code CMS for creating dynamic mobile microsites and smart QR codes that last for decades. Its rules-based routing allows you to deliver customized experiences to your users based on their location, device, or language. If your business requires a highly scalable and compliant infrastructure to manage millions of redirects with zero downtime, this platform is your best option.

GoLinks

GoLinks reimagines the URL shortener for internal team productivity by turning long URLs into short, memorable keywords that you can type directly into your browser. You can use simple aliases like "go/benefits" or "go/roadmap" to help your employees find internal resources and documentation in seconds. This eliminates the need for your team to hunt through bookmarks or messy shared drives to locate essential company information.

Moreover, the platform integrates with your existing workspace tools like Slack and Google Workspace to make sharing these links effortless across your entire organization. You also get access to usage analytics, which help you understand which resources are most valuable to your team members. If you want to improve your internal knowledge management and save your staff hours of searching time every week, this productivity-focused tool is the perfect fit.
